1990 Mercury Tracer vs. 2010 Saturn Vue
To start off, 2010 Saturn Vue is newer by 20 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 Mercury Tracer.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 Mercury Tracer would be higher. At 3,490 cc (6 cylinders), 2010 Saturn Vue is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Saturn Vue (222 HP @ 5900 RPM) has 134 more horse power than 1990 Mercury Tracer. (88 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Saturn Vue should accelerate faster than 1990 Mercury Tracer.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2010 Saturn Vue weights approximately 685 kg more than 1990 Mercury Tracer.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2010 Saturn Vue is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1990 Mercury Tracer.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2010 Saturn Vue will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Saturn Vue (297 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 151 more torque (in Nm) than 1990 Mercury Tracer. (146 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2010 Saturn Vue will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1990 Mercury Tracer.
